Treasures from the Sicilian Seas
For 2500 years, Sicily was the place where the great powers of the ancient and medieval eras met and fought. Phoenicians, Greeks, Romans, Byzantines, Arabs and Normans battled for control, with many of their ships sinking off the island's rocky shores.

Discover the extraordinary story of the island at the crossroads of the Mediterranean through spectacular finds rescued from the sea by underwater archaeologists.
